About Health and Medical Administrative Services Careers

You'll likely begin your career at the heart of a healthcare facility, like a bustling clinic or hospital department. Your days will be a fast-paced mix of patient interaction and digital organization, managing patient flow with scheduling software, updating electronic health records (EHRs), and navigating insurance billing codes. Some paths, like medical assisting, also involve hands-on clinical tasks like taking patient vitals.
